Why AI matters at this scale
LiveTen Media Services operates in the sweet spot for AI adoption: a mid-market firm (201-500 employees) with a tech-forward service line in live streaming and event production. The company is large enough to have recurring operational pain points that justify investment, yet nimble enough to deploy new tools without the bureaucratic inertia of a mega-enterprise. The events industry is undergoing a seismic shift where virtual and hybrid formats are no longer a pandemic-era stopgap but a permanent, high-growth segment. AI is the key differentiator that separates a basic stream from a premium, data-rich experience that commands higher margins.
At this size, LiveTen likely produces hundreds of events annually, generating terabytes of video, audio, and engagement data that currently sit underutilized. The manual effort in editing, captioning, and proving sponsor value is a linear cost that scales poorly with growth. AI introduces a non-linear improvement: once a model is trained, the marginal cost of analyzing another hour of footage or generating another highlight reel approaches zero. This shifts the business model from selling hours to selling outcomes.
3 Concrete AI Opportunities with ROI Framing
1. Automated Post-Production Pipeline
The highest immediate ROI lies in automating the grueling post-event workflow. A typical 3-hour corporate keynote might require 8-12 hours of human editing to produce short clips. Computer vision models can identify speakers, slides, and audience reactions to auto-generate a rough cut in minutes. Assuming an average fully-loaded editor cost of $50/hour, saving 10 hours per event across 200 events yields $100,000 in annual direct labor savings. More importantly, it slashes turnaround time from days to hours, enabling clients to capitalize on real-time social media momentum.
2. Real-Time Sponsor Intelligence Dashboard
Sponsorship sales are the lifeblood of event revenue, yet proving ROI to sponsors remains a murky art. Deploying object detection models to track logo visibility and NLP to measure sentiment around sponsor mentions creates a new product offering. LiveTen can sell a "Sponsor Analytics Suite" as an upsell. If just 30% of events add a $2,000 analytics package, that's $120,000 in new high-margin recurring revenue annually, while also increasing sponsor retention and renewal rates.
3. Intelligent Audience Engagement & Matchmaking
For virtual and hybrid events, attendee engagement is the metric that determines long-term success. An AI-powered recommendation engine can analyze attendee profiles, session attendance, and chat activity to suggest networking connections and relevant content. This increases perceived value and attendee satisfaction scores. Higher NPS scores directly correlate with repeat ticket sales and premium pricing. A 10% increase in attendee retention for a series of annual conferences can compound into significant revenue growth over three years.
Deployment Risks Specific to This Size Band
Mid-market firms face a unique "valley of death" in AI adoption. LiveTen is too large to rely on free-tier tools but may lack the capital for a dedicated in-house AI team. The primary risk is vendor lock-in with a platform that doesn't fully meet specialized production needs. Mitigation involves choosing tools with open APIs and avoiding black-box solutions. The second risk is talent churn; hiring a machine learning engineer in a competitive Los Angeles market is expensive, and losing that person can stall projects. A hybrid approach—pairing a strategic AI product manager with outsourced model development—often proves more resilient. Finally, client data sensitivity is paramount. A single incident of leaked proprietary event footage due to a misconfigured cloud AI pipeline could be catastrophic for reputation. Robust data governance and client communication about AI processing must be foundational, not an afterthought.

6 agent deployments worth exploring for liveten media services
Automated Live Highlight Reels
Use computer vision and audio sentiment analysis to automatically clip key moments from live streams into short, branded highlight reels for social media.
Real-time Sponsor Analytics
Track logo visibility, mention frequency, and viewer engagement with sponsored content during streams to provide instant ROI dashboards to sponsors.
AI-Powered Closed Captioning & Translation
Generate highly accurate, real-time captions and multi-language translations for live streams to increase accessibility and global reach.
Intelligent Chat Moderation & Engagement
Deploy NLP chatbots to moderate Q&A, answer common attendee questions, and escalate complex issues to human staff during virtual events.
Predictive Event Logistics Planning
Analyze historical event data to predict equipment needs, staffing levels, and bandwidth requirements, reducing overage costs and technical failures.
Personalized Content Recommendations
Use attendee profile and behavior data to recommend sessions, networking opportunities, and on-demand content within the event platform.
